Upstox Account Opening: A Step-by-Step Guide
Now, let’s dive into the nitty-gritty of the Upstox account opening process. It’s simpler than you might think!
Step 1: Gather Your Documents
Before you begin the application process, make sure you have the following documents readily available in digital format (scanned copies or clear photos):
- PAN Card: Absolutely essential! This is your primary identification document.
- Aadhar Card: Linked to your mobile number, this is crucial for e-KYC verification.
- Bank Account Proof: A cancelled cheque, bank statement (not older than 3 months), or a copy of your bank passbook. This is needed to link your bank account to your trading account.
- Passport-Sized Photograph: A recent photograph for verification purposes.
- Income Proof (if required): For trading in futures and options (F&O), you may need to provide income proof such as your latest salary slip, ITR acknowledgement, or bank statement. This is to ensure you understand the risks associated with F&O trading.
Step 2: Initiate the Online Application
Visit the Upstox website or download the Upstox mobile app and click on the “Open Demat Account” button. You’ll be prompted to enter your mobile number and email address. Make sure these details are accurate, as you’ll receive important updates and notifications on them.
Step 3: Verify Your Mobile Number and Email ID
Upstox will send you an OTP (One-Time Password) to your registered mobile number and email address. Enter these OTPs to verify your contact details. This is a standard security measure to ensure that the application is genuine.
Step 4: Enter Your PAN and Date of Birth
Carefully enter your PAN card number and date of birth as mentioned on your PAN card. Any discrepancies can lead to delays in the account opening process.
Step 5: Fill in Your Personal Details
You’ll be asked to provide personal information such as your name, gender, marital status, occupation, and address. Ensure that all the details are accurate and match the information on your Aadhar card.
Step 6: Choose Your Trading Preferences
Select your trading preferences, such as the segments you want to trade in (equity, F&O, currency, commodities). You’ll also need to choose your leverage settings. Leverage can amplify your profits but also your losses, so choose wisely based on your risk appetite. Consider it like driving a car – more power means more responsibility!
Step 7: Bank Account Details
Enter your bank account details, including the account number, IFSC code, and account type (savings or current). Upstox will verify your bank account by depositing a small amount (usually ₹1) into your account. This is a crucial step to ensure that the bank account is linked correctly to your trading account.
Step 8: Upload Documents
Upload the scanned copies or photos of the documents you gathered in Step 1. Ensure that the documents are clear and legible. Poor quality images can lead to rejection of your application.
Step 9: E-Sign Your Application
This is where your Aadhar card comes into play. Upstox uses e-KYC (electronic Know Your Customer) to verify your identity and address using your Aadhar card. You’ll need to enter your Aadhar number and authenticate it using an OTP sent to your registered mobile number. This is a completely secure and paperless process.
Step 10: Choose Your Brokerage Plan
Upstox offers different brokerage plans to cater to various trading styles. Compare the plans and choose the one that best suits your needs. Some plans offer zero brokerage for certain segments, while others offer lower brokerage fees for high-volume traders.
Step 11: Account Activation
Once you’ve completed all the steps, your application will be reviewed by Upstox. This usually takes a few hours to a couple of days. Once your account is approved, you’ll receive an email and SMS with your login credentials. Congratulations, you’re now ready to start trading!
Understanding KYC: Know Your Customer
KYC, or Know Your Customer, is a mandatory process for all financial institutions in India, including brokerage firms like Upstox. It’s a regulatory requirement mandated by SEBI (Securities and Exchange Board of India) to prevent money laundering and other illegal activities. The e-KYC process, facilitated by Aadhar, has made KYC verification incredibly quick and convenient.
Brokerage Charges: Understanding the Costs
Brokerage charges are the fees you pay to your broker for executing trades on your behalf. Upstox offers different brokerage plans, so it’s important to understand the costs involved before you start trading. Key things to consider are:
- Equity Delivery: The brokerage charged for buying and holding shares for the long term.
- Intraday Trading: The brokerage charged for buying and selling shares on the same day.
- Futures & Options (F&O): The brokerage charged for trading in derivatives.
- Hidden Charges: Be aware of any hidden charges, such as account maintenance fees or transaction fees.

Beyond Account Opening: Getting Started with Investing
Opening an Upstox account is just the first step. Once your account is active, you can start exploring the world of investing. Here are a few popular investment options:
- Equity Shares: Buying shares of publicly listed companies on the NSE and BSE.
- Mutual Funds: Investing in professionally managed funds that invest in a diversified portfolio of stocks, bonds, or other assets. Consider SIPs (Systematic Investment Plans) for disciplined investing.
- IPOs (Initial Public Offerings): Investing in newly listed companies on the stock exchange.
- ELSS (Equity Linked Savings Scheme): Tax-saving mutual funds that invest primarily in equity shares.
